Stakelogic expands in Denmark with Casino House

Denmark continues to be the focal point of interest for many casinos and suppliers, as the country welcomes yet another supplier. Stakelogic’s local footprint though has been well-established as this is not the first time that the company is presenting its products to local operators.

The latest tie-up puts Stakelogic in a content alliance with Casino House, offering the operator access to the supplier’s extensive library of games, which include classic and video slots. Among these are such excellent games as Super Bonus Wild, Super 6 Timer, Mega Runner, and Bonus Runner.

Stakelogic introduces a range of experiences and game features, such as multipliers, wilds, expanding features, and free spins. Casino House is also hosting a range of player-favorite video slots by Stakelogic moving forward, including Wild Wild Bass 2, Eric’s Big Catch, Money Track 2, Greedy Fox, and more.

The partnership was welcomed by Casino House Casino Manager Thomas Vandsted who hailed the opportunity to see the website secure more worthwhile content that is set to be a hit with local players.

"The variety and quality of its portfolio are unrivalled, covering both classic and video slots," Vandsted added. Stakelogic Senior Sales Manager Danila Dzehs was similarly excited at the opportunity and said that players in Denmark already have a well-established taste for strong-quality games.

Dzehs added that the market has a huge demand for cutting-edge classic and video slots the kind that Stakelogic was able to supply locally and truly elevate the company’s offer. Stakelogic has done an excellent job of expanding locally in Europe, with the company recently entering a similar content alliance with Starcasino in Belgium.

As to the Danish iGaming market, the region has been developing rapidly, introducing new suppliers and brands locally. Betsson has just confirmed that it is rebranding Casino.dk to the eponymous brand, in a bid to strengthen its branding locally.

The continued and sustained interest in Denmark from operators and suppliers comes at a time when local regulators are continuing to take the necessary measures that lead to stronger channelization into the regulated gambling market.

Spillemyndigheden, the Dutch Gaming Authority, has confirmed that it has blocked 49 illegal gambling websites in its latest effort to keep the industry safe and free from unauthorized parties.
